I have a simple question, but Im sure the answer's arnt so simple......I am really looking for that "deep" sound, I have a 09 Street Glide, all stock, I cant afford a new system, so would slip on's give me the sound Im looking for? And........if adding slip on's, do I have to have the system adjusted? ...Im not looking for performence changes just sound..........Thank you in advance.....Will

I have the 2" rush slip ons. Nothing else has to be done with these. With these you can change the baffles to either bigger or smaller. If you go bigger you will have to make some changes. I have about 7000 miles on mine they sound better when they get broken in. These will work untill later on when I can afford true duals and the warrenty is up.
